Dr. Peggy Brouse is Associate Chair and Professor in the Cyber Security Engineering (CYSE) department at George Mason University. She created the first Cyber Security Engineering undergraduate program in the country. She is also Professor and founder of the Systems Engineering department. Before Mason, Dr. Brouse worked as a Program Director at the MITRE Corporation, a database analyst at CACI and systems analyst at the U.S. Army Computer Systems Command. Dr. Brouse is a member of the Virginia Cyber Range Executive Committee. She is also a member of the IEEE, ASEE and INCOSE. Within INCOSE, she served as the director of the Academic Forum. Degrees earned: BS in Computer Science, American University; MBA, Marymount University and Ph.D. INFT, George Mason University.
